
“You KNOW it’s a NO if you don’t ask.” -Elisabeth Caetano
I came up with this quote to tell my daughter to empower herself to get her needs met. I want to teach her that it is up to her, not anyone else, to mind read or figure out what she needs and just give it to her.
Don’t reject yourself by not asking. We erroneously think that it doesn’t feel as bad if we just say no to ourselves, rather than having someone else say no to us. Don’t personalize a “no” from someone else. The price we pay in hurt by not asking is feeling anger an resentment. So ask away and let a no roll right over you! You never KNOW, it may be a YES!
